Monday, Tuesday, Wednesday and Thursday
3rd, 4th, 5th and 6th April, 1939, at 8.15 p.m.

THE STORY BROUGHT BY BRIGHT
A Passion Play in Three Acts, by LADY GREGORY
[…]
There will be Intervals of Ten Minutes between the Acts
[…]
Music composed and arranged by F. M. MAY, Mus. Bac.
[…]

The Orchestra under the direction of F. M. MAY, Mus. Bac., will perform the following selections:
Prelude Lohengrin Wagner (1813-1883)
Two Pieces (a) Air on the G String Bach (1685-1750) (b) Panis Angelicus César Franck (1822-1890)
Fantasie Parsifal Wagner (1813-1883)
